Output 8a8662162539ad9613c0a2efde930ec9eaeffa4788e8f4673895ae85c1ac63e5:1

value
313669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1197866803acf00845cd941c6f0983eaedbdaa3a OP_EQUAL
address
33J2vwwqj2uYhBXP3CdWUoc5oQ2UTWXWAV
transaction
8a8662162539ad9613c0a2efde930ec9eaeffa4788e8f4673895ae85c1ac63e5
confirmations
292844
spent
true